Subject: Re: [PATCH rdma-next 00/10] IPoIB uninit

On Sun, Jul 29, 2018 at 11:34:50AM +0300, Leon Romanovsky wrote:
> From: Leon Romanovsky <leonro@...lanox.com>
> 
> IP link was broken due to the changes in IPoIB for the rdma_netdev
> support after commit cd565b4b51e5 ("IB/IPoIB: Support acceleration options callbacks").
> 
> This patchset restores IPoIB pkey creation and removal using rtnetlink.
